A Handmade Favor Guide for Promise, Engagement and Wedding Celebrations

An intimate family ceremony, an engagement and a wedding may belong to one story, yet each has a different atmosphere. The favors do not need to repeat; a shared color or symbol can create continuity.
Detailed pieces for intimate gatherings
For a small home celebration, personalized candles, sweet boxes or fragrance bottles work well. Lower quantities may allow more detailed customization.
Coordinate engagement favors with the table
Match the palette to flowers, trays and the backdrop. Consider the product’s height and the table space it occupies before approving the design.
Prioritize production and distribution at weddings
With larger guest lists, choose designs suited to batch production and simple distribution. Combining a place card and favor can save space.
Plan the complete budget
Include labels, ribbons, filling, boxes and shipping. Tell the maker your budget range and essential details so suitable alternatives can be suggested efficiently.
